Sdílet prostřednictvím


HttpRuntimeSection.MinFreeThreads Vlastnost

Definice

Získá nebo nastaví minimální počet vláken, které musí být zdarma, aby bylo možné provést žádost o prostředky v tomto oboru konfigurace.

public:
 property int MinFreeThreads { int get(); void set(int value); };
[System.Configuration.ConfigurationProperty("minFreeThreads", DefaultValue=8)]
[System.Configuration.IntegerValidator(MinValue=0)]
public int MinFreeThreads { get; set; }
[<System.Configuration.ConfigurationProperty("minFreeThreads", DefaultValue=8)>]
[<System.Configuration.IntegerValidator(MinValue=0)>]
member this.MinFreeThreads : int with get, set
Public Property MinFreeThreads As Integer

Hodnota vlastnosti

Před provedením požadavku v tomto oboru konfigurace se provede minimální počet bezplatných vláken ve fondu vláken CLR (Common Language Runtime). Výchozí hodnota je 8.

Atributy

Příklady

Následující příklad ukazuje, jak použít MinFreeThreads vlastnost.

// Get the MinFreeThreads property value.
Response.Write("MinFreeThreads: " +
  configSection.MinFreeThreads + "<br>");

// Set the MinFreeThreads property value to 16
configSection.MinFreeThreads = 16;
' Get the MinFreeThreads property value.
Response.Write("MinFreeThreads: " & _
  configSection.MinFreeThreads & "<br>")

' Set the MinFreeThreads property value to 16
configSection.MinFreeThreads = 16

Poznámky

Vlastnost MinFreeThreads definuje minimální počet volných vláken pro provedení požadavku. Pokud není k dispozici dostatečný počet vláken, požadavek zůstane ve frontě a pravidelné kontroly dostupnosti vlákna budou pokračovat, dokud nebude k dispozici požadované množství vláken. Výchozí hodnota je 8.

Poznámka:

ASP.NET udržuje tento počet vláken zdarma pro požadavky, které vyžadují další vlákna k dokončení jejich zpracování.

Platí pro

Viz také